@media (max-width: 1585px) {


}
@media (max-width: 1360px) {


}
@media (max-width: 960px) {

	main {
		width:100vw;
	}
	body {
		padding-top:65px;
	}
	#header {
		display:none;
	}
	#mobilheader {
		display:flex;
	}
	#mobilmenu {
		display:block;
	}

	#mobilmenu {
		display:block;
		position:fixed;
		top:0px;
		left:0px;
		width:100%;
		height:100%;
		z-index:1000;
		transform: translateY(-200%);
		transition:all 0.3s ease;
	}

	#mobilmenu .ic {
		margin-left:0px;
	}

	#mobilmenu .menu {
		padding:20px 20px;
	}
	#mobilmenu .menu ul {
		align-items:center;
		grid-gap:20px;
	}
	#mobilmenu .menu .link-item {
		font-size:30px;
		line-height:40px;
	}

	#mobilmenu .form {
		padding:20px 20px;
		text-align:center;
	}
	#mobilmenu .form .formbas {
		font-size:30px;
		line-height:40px;
		margin-bottom:20px;
	}


	/*------------------sayfa----------------------*/

	.sayfa {
		position:relative;
		display:flex;
		flex-wrap:wrap;
	}
	.sayfa .sayfasol {
		display:none;
	}
	.sayfa .sayfasag {
		width:calc(100% - 0px);
		height:auto;
		overflow-y:inherit;
		padding:0px 15px;
	}

	.sayfa .video {
		height:50vh;
	}
	/*------------------slider----------------------*/

	#slider {
		height:50vh;
	}
	#slider .yazi1 {
		font-size:30px;
	}
	#slider .yazi1 strong {
		font-size:50px;
	}

	/*------------------hakkimizda----------------------*/

	#hakkimizda {
		padding:30px 0px;
	}
	#hakkimizda .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#hakkimizda .yazi1 {
		font-size:16px;
		line-height:30px;
		margin-bottom:20px;
	}
	#hakkimizda .yazi2 {
		font-size:26px;
		line-height:34px;
	}
	#hakkimizda .resim {
		width:100%;
		margin-bottom:20px;
	}
	#hakkimizda .yazi3 {
		font-size:26px;
		line-height:34px;
		margin-bottom:20px;
	}
	#hakkimizda .yazi4 {
		font-size:14px;
		line-height:22px;
		margin-bottom:20px;
	}

	/*------------------sertifikalar----------------------*/

	#sertifikalar {
		padding:30px 0px;
	}
	#sertifikalar .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#sertifikalar .yazi1 {
		font-size:16px;
		line-height:24px;
		margin-bottom:0px;
	}

	.sertifika {
		position:relative;
		display:block;
	}
	.sertifika img {
		width:100%;
		aspect-ratio:455/260;
		object-fit:cover;
		object-position:center;
	}
	
	/*------------------fotograflar----------------------*/

	#fotograflar {
		padding:30px 0px;
	}
	#fotograflar .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#fotograflar .yazi1 {
		font-size:16px;
		line-height:24px;
		margin-bottom:0px;
	}

	.galeri {
		position:relative;
		display:block;
	}
	.galeri img {
		width:100%;
		aspect-ratio:455/355;
		object-fit:cover;
		object-position:center;
	}


	/*------------------bizeulasin----------------------*/

	#bizeulasin {
		padding:30px 0px;
	}
	#bizeulasin .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#bizeulasin .yazi1 {
		font-size:16px;
		line-height:24px;
		margin-bottom:0px;
	}

	#bizeulasin .bilgi {
		margin-bottom:20px;
	}
	#bizeulasin .bilgi .icon {
		width:40px;
		font-size:26px;
		color:var(--anarenk);
	}
	#bizeulasin .bilgi .yazi {
		width:calc(100% - 40px);
		font-size: 16px;
		line-height: 24px; /* 230.769% */
	}
	/*------------------footer----------------------*/

	#footer {
		padding:20px 0px 20px 0px;
		display:flex;
		align-items:center;
		flex-direction:column;
		justify-content:center;
	}
	#footer .copy {
		font-size:14px;
		line-height:20px;
		margin-right:0px;
	}
	#footer .linkler {
		display:none;
	}

	/*------------------hakkimizdapage----------------------*/

	#hakkimizdapage {
		padding:30px 0px;
	}
	#hakkimizdapage .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#hakkimizdapage .yazi1 {
		font-size:42px;
		line-height:50px;
	}
	#hakkimizdapage .yazi2 {
		font-size:26px;
		line-height:34px;
	}


	/*------------------koleksiyonlarpage----------------------*/


	#koleksiyonlarpage {
		padding:30px 0px;
	}
	#koleksiyonlarpage .ustalan {
		margin-bottom:20px;
		padding-bottom:20px;
	}
	#koleksiyonlarpage .yazi1 {
		font-size:42px;
		line-height:50px;
	}
	#koleksiyonlarpage .yazi2 {
		font-size:26px;
		line-height:34px;
	}


	#koleksiyonlarpage .bilgi {
		position:relative;
		display:flex;
		flex-wrap:wrap;
		align-items:center;
		margin-bottom:20px;
	}
	#koleksiyonlarpage .bilgi .icon {
		width:40px;
		font-size:26px;
		color:var(--anarenk);
	}
	#koleksiyonlarpage .bilgi .yazi {
		width:calc(100% - 40px);
		color: #fff;
		font-size: 20px;
		font-style: normal;
		font-weight: 400;
		line-height: 30px; /* 230.769% */
	}
	#koleksiyonlarpage .form-control {
		border-radius:0px;
		border:1px solid var(--anarenk);
		color:var(--anarenk);
		background:transparent;
	}
	#koleksiyonlarpage .form-check-label {
		color:#fff;
		font-size:12px;
	}
	.halilar {
		position:relative;
		display:block;
	}
	.halilar img {
		width:100%;
	}	
	
}
